The French government has given it's green light to an agreement, set up by the French Minister of Sport, Marie-George Buffet, and Max Mosley of the FIA. The agreement settles the dispute about TV broadcasting rights of the French Grand Prix that, up until now, hasn't shown up on the 1998 calendar. Max Mosley wil then give the text a final rundown by his lawyers. The French government awaits this decision before handing the text over to the 'Conseil d'Etat'. This advising body will give a final advise to the French Government. If all goes well then the decision can finally be made on December 11 in Monaco to add the French Grand Prix to the race calendar for 1998. The Grand Prix will then propably be staged on June 28.
